Video: Boeing 737-700 Nose Gear Collapse At Airport GateOn January 8th, a Boeing 737-700 operated by TUI Fly Belgium was parked at a gate at Brussels Airport when its nose gear collapsed. No passengers were onboard and there were no reported injuries.

Interesting Engineering on MSNUS Air Force builds $80M F-35A for just $6M by merging parts from two crashed jetsThe US Air Force has successfully restored an F-35A Lightning II by merging two damaged jets, saving over $74 million.
